Calculator notes

  • Annual saving = kWh avoided × (grid rate − FiT). This is the true arbitrage value: the difference between what you'd pay vs. what you'd earn by exporting.
  • Payback = net cost ÷ year-1 saving. Actual payback may be faster if electricity prices rise.
  • Degradation reduces kWh output each year. 10-year figures account for this compounding effect.
  • Does not include VPP income, time-of-use arbitrage, or blackout protection value — all of which can improve returns.
